Wings Iron Ore Mine
 

 


Wings Enterprises is a fully permitted iron mine with 38 years of operating history: formerly as Pea Ridge. Today the mine is currently producting specialty iron oxides (+70% Fe, 98% magnetic) and is reopening as a multi-product, value added producer of chemical quality and specialty iron oxides, pig iron, rare earth oxides and other valuable byproducts. Wings will be the only domestic producer for all of these products.

North East United States and Canada
Average combined reserve life for all of the NE Iron Range, including Canada is approximately 40 years. The reserve quality also continues to decline throughout the N.E. Iron Range as total Fe ore grade continues to fall and while of the best ore is bound by seasonal shipping issues. Source: USGS

China

China recently completed an internal reserve estimate for all known mainland iron ore deposits. The expected life for all known reserves was estimated at 20 years. Souce: Bejing - 2006 Blue Book


Wings Iron Ore / Pea Ridge Reserve Overview

  • - Assays show iron content from 50%-70% grade DoR

  • - Total Probable Surface Reserves: 4,300,000 short tons (st)

  • - Total Proven Sub-Surface Reserves: 174,000,000 (st)

  • - Total Probable Sub-Surface Reserves: 500,000,000 (st)

  • - Life of Est. Reserves at 3,500,000/year: 50-140 years
